What Are Cookies?
Cookies are a feature of Web browser software that allows Web servers to recognize the
computer used to access a Web site. They are small pieces of data that are stored by a
user's Web browser on the user's hard drive. Cookies can remember what information a user
accesses on one Web page to simplify subsequent interactions with that Web site by the
same user or to use the information to streamline the user's transactions on related Web
pages. This makes it easier for a user to move from Web page to Web page and to complete
commercial transactions over the Internet. Cookies should make your online experience
easier and more personalized.
